Cumberland University is in Lebanon, TN.

During the most recent reporting year, 21 teacher education subject specific degrees were granted at Cumberland University.

Online Class Availability at Cumberland University

Online coursework is an option at Cumberland University. Of 3,457 students, 400 (12%) studied exclusively online and 1,350 (39%) took at least some classes online.

Earnings for Teacher Education Subject Specific Graduates from Cumberland University

Those who finish Cumberland University’s Teacher Education Subject Specific program report the following median earnings (per the U.S. Department of Education’s College Scorecard):

Median earnings by years after graduation for Teacher Education Subject Specific at Cumberland University
Years After Graduation Median Earnings
1 year $42,951
2 years $41,937

Student Demographics & Diversity

Below you’ll find the composition of Teacher Education Subject Specific graduates at Cumberland University, broken down by degree level.

Looking at the program as a whole, Teacher Education Subject Specific graduates at Cumberland University are 62% women (13) and 38% men (8).

Teacher Education Subject Specific Master’s Program at Cumberland University

Of the 21 master’s teacher education subject specific graduates at Cumberland University, 62% were women (13) and 38% were men (8).

Cumberland University gender breakdown of Teacher Education Subject Specific Master's degree recipients

The following table and chart show the race/ethnicity of Teacher Education Subject Specific master’s degree recipients at Cumberland University.

Race / Ethnicity Number of Graduates
White 16
Black / African American 3
Unknown 2
Racial-ethnic diversity of Teacher Education Subject Specific majors at Cumberland University

Racial-ethnic minorities make up 14% of Teacher Education Subject Specific master’s degree recipients at Cumberland University, lower than the national average of 23%.*

*The racial-ethnic minorities figure is the total number of graduates minus White, international (nonresident), and unknown-race graduates.
